3. What's Inside
- Module 1: Advanced OOP Concepts – Deep dive into inheritance, polymorphism, and interfaces.
- Module 2: Collections Framework – Learn to manage complex datasets with lists, sets, and maps.
- Module 3: Exception Management – Handle multiple exception types and create custom exceptions.
- Module 4: File & Data Processing – Read, write, and manipulate files programmatically.
- Module 5: Project 1 – Inventory System – Build a functional Java application integrating all modules.
- Module 6: Debugging Techniques – Learn strategies to identify and fix logical and runtime errors.
- Module 7: Modular Project Design – Organize large projects into reusable and maintainable modules.
- Module 8: Best Practices & Next Steps – Tips to move smoothly to advanced courses and real-world applications.
